The Role of Antioxidants in Respiratory Health

Antioxidants play a crucial role in supporting respiratory health by protecting cells from damage caused by free radicals. Free radicals are unstable molecules that can contribute to inflammation and respiratory diseases. Superfoods rich in antioxidants, such as blueberries, kale, and spinach, provide considerable benefits for the lungs. Blueberries, in particular, are renowned for their capacity to enhance lung function due to their high levels of flavonoids. Kale and spinach are excellent choices for boosting overall wellness. Leafy greens contain vitamins A, C, and E and other essential micronutrients that help support lung health. Incorporating these superfoods into your diet can improve airway function and respiratory performance, especially in those with chronic respiratory conditions. Moreover, a well-balanced diet that includes a variety of superfoods can help lower oxidative stress levels. Such a balanced approach to eating not only nourishes the body but also empowers the immune system. The incorporation of colorful fruits and vegetables in your daily meals can ensure that you receive ample antioxidants, ultimately leading to better health outcomes.

Maintaining a hearty diet rich in superfoods also promotes better respiratory function as it helps with the prevention of allergic reactions and respiratory inflammations. Foods like sweet potatoes, carrots, and bell peppers are packed with beta-carotene, which is converted into Vitamin A in the body. Vitamin A plays a crucial role in maintaining the integrity of the respiratory mucosa, acting as a protective barrier against irritants and pathogens. Including these vibrant vegetables in your meals can enhance the body’s ability to respond to internal and external threats. Additionally, certain superfoods such as green tea offer powerful anti-inflammatory effects and are known to enhance overall respiratory function. Regular green tea consumption can help soothe irritation in the respiratory tract and reduce symptoms of allergies. Superfoods and their Impact on Immune Function

The positive effects of superfoods on immune function are profound, as these foods help modulate the immune system’s responses. Certain superfoods such as mushrooms, particularly shiitake and reishi, are known for their ability to enhance the body’s immune response while reducing inflammation. Nutrients found in mushrooms, such as beta-glucans, can stimulate the production of immune cells and have been shown to help the body fight off infections more effectively. Additionally, foods rich in zinc, such as pumpkin seeds, boost immune function and play a vital role in maintaining respiratory health. Consuming adequate zinc is essential, as it helps produce and activate immune cells that respond to pathogens. Using pumpkin seeds as a snack or adding them to various recipes can ensure adequate intake of this important mineral.
